De Allende stands with Bongi over racial allegations: 'He didn't do anything wrong'

PARIS. - Springbok centre Damian de Allende provided the best in-team clarity regarding allegations of a racial slur by Bongi Mbonambi, saying the Bok hooker didn't do anything wrong.

Mbonambi had a second consecutive Rugby World Cup final to forget, coming off in the third minute with a knee injury after being caught in a neck roll by All Black flank Shannon Frizzell.
